随着信息技术的发展,分布式系统在各个领域得到了广泛应用。在能源管理系统中,分布式追踪技术的应用显得尤为重要。本文将从深度理解分布式追踪的角度出发,探讨如何提升能源管理系统的效率。

一、分布式追踪概述

分布式追踪是一种用于监控分布式系统中各个组件之间交互的技术。它能够帮助我们快速定位问题,优化系统性能。在能源管理系统中,分布式追踪可以帮助我们了解能源消耗、设备运行状态等信息,从而实现高效管理。

二、分布式追踪在能源管理系统中的应用

  1. 能源消耗监控

分布式追踪可以帮助我们实时监控能源消耗情况。通过对各个设备的能源消耗数据进行追踪,我们可以发现能源浪费的环节,为节能降耗提供依据。例如,在电力系统中,分布式追踪可以追踪电力设备的使用情况,发现哪些设备存在异常消耗,进而采取措施降低能耗。


  1. 设备运行状态监控

能源管理系统中的设备众多,分布式追踪可以帮助我们实时了解设备的运行状态。通过对设备运行数据的追踪,我们可以及时发现设备故障,提前进行维护,降低设备停机时间,提高能源利用率。


  1. 性能优化

分布式追踪可以帮助我们分析系统性能瓶颈,为优化提供依据。通过对系统各个组件的交互过程进行追踪,我们可以发现哪些组件存在性能问题,从而针对性地进行优化。


  1. 安全监控

能源管理系统涉及大量敏感数据,分布式追踪可以帮助我们及时发现安全漏洞。通过对系统各个组件的交互过程进行追踪,我们可以发现异常行为,为安全防护提供支持。

三、深度理解分布式追踪

  1. 分布式追踪原理

分布式追踪主要通过以下步骤实现:

(1)数据采集:从各个组件中采集相关数据,包括日志、性能指标等。

(2)数据传输:将采集到的数据传输到追踪系统中。

(3)数据存储:将传输过来的数据存储在分布式数据库中。

(4)数据分析:对存储的数据进行分析,发现异常情况。


  1. 分布式追踪关键技术

(1)链路追踪:追踪系统中各个组件之间的调用关系,形成调用链路。

(2)数据可视化:将追踪数据以图表等形式展示,便于分析。

(3)实时监控:对追踪数据进行实时监控,及时发现异常情况。

(4)日志分析:对系统日志进行分析,发现潜在问题。

四、提升能源管理系统效率的策略

  1. 优化分布式追踪架构

为了提高分布式追踪的效率,我们可以从以下几个方面进行优化:

(1)选择合适的追踪框架:根据实际需求选择合适的分布式追踪框架,如Zipkin、Jaeger等。

(2)优化数据采集:减少数据采集过程中的延迟,提高数据采集效率。

(3)提高数据传输速度:采用高效的数据传输协议,如gRPC、HTTP/2等。

(4)优化数据存储:选择性能优异的分布式数据库,如Cassandra、Elasticsearch等。


  1. 深度挖掘数据价值

通过对分布式追踪数据的深度挖掘,我们可以发现更多潜在问题,为优化能源管理系统提供依据。以下是一些具体策略:

(1)建立数据模型:对追踪数据进行建模,分析数据之间的关联性。

(2)数据可视化:将数据以图表等形式展示,便于分析。

(3)异常检测:对追踪数据进行异常检测,及时发现潜在问题。


  1. 加强安全防护

分布式追踪在提升能源管理系统效率的同时,也需要加强安全防护。以下是一些具体措施:

(1)数据加密:对敏感数据进行加密,确保数据安全。

(2)访问控制:对追踪系统进行访问控制,防止未授权访问。

(3)安全审计:对追踪系统进行安全审计,及时发现安全隐患。

总之,深度理解分布式追踪对于提升能源管理系统的效率具有重要意义。通过优化分布式追踪架构、挖掘数据价值以及加强安全防护,我们可以实现能源管理系统的智能化、高效化。